英文摘要The efficient deployment of Big Data processing tasks in cloud environments is the basic core function of Big Data processing, which refers to the effective deployment of tasks to the computing resources of cloud platforms, achieving high-performance and high-throughput data processing. In this process, task deployment needs to consider load balancing on the cloud platform to ensure that tasks can be evenly deployed to each computing node. However, currently in the process of providing services on cloud platforms, the available resources of all hosts will be automatically and dynamically readjusted, and it cannot be guaranteed that each task will be deployed to the host with the most remaining resources. This load imbalance in the platform will result in computational results that cannot be returned to users in a timely and effective manner. So, a heuristic multi-task efficient deployment approach for Big Data processing based on QoS awareness and Bayesian classification in cloud environments called QBC is proposed. The QBC first performs long-run QoS awareness on hosts in the cloud; Then, based on user task requirements, selects host nodes that meet QoS constraints to form a candidate set, and performs Bayesian classification to find the host node which has highest a posteriori probability to serve as the clustering center; third, designs an objective function based on euclidean spatial distance to acquire the optimum host clustering set in the candidate set; Finally, deploys the user's tasks to this optimal host cluster set. The experimental results show that this approach implements optimization of long-run load balancing in Big Data cloud platforms with minimal resource consumption, enhances the ability of the cloud platform to provide external support, and thus promotes efficient deployment of multitasking in Big Data processing under cloud computing. The proposed QBC based framework reduces the overall Energy Consumption by an average of 47.98%, MakeSpan by an average of 24.42%, Total Cost by an average of 30.17%, Average Waiting Time by an average of 36.92%, and the Throughput is increased by an average of 41.93% as compared to the existing algorithms.
